The gaming hardware market is expected to grow steadily between 2025 and 2035 on the strength of growing demand for high-performance gaming consoles, computer gaming peripherals, and interactive gaming technologies. The market is also expected to reach USD 40.43 billion in 2025 and reach USD 65.43 billion by 2035 at a compound annual growth rate (CAGR) of 4.9% over the forecast period.
As the pace of the trend towards esports, cloud gaming, and virtual reality (VR) gaming accelerates, the players are making investments in AI-driven gaming peripherals, next-gen GPUs, and cloud-connected gaming consoles. The addition of haptic feedback, ray-tracing technology, and high-refresh-rate panels is also adding further to a more immersive gaming experience.
Besides, cloud gaming technologies in hardware, wireless gaming peripherals, and adaptive controllers are transforming the game. Ergonomic and high-precision gaming peripherals like programmable gamepads, motion-sensing cameras, and wireless headsets are required because gamers require more comfort and responsiveness.

High-performance console, gaming PC and peripherals categories powered the industry growth surge between 2020 and 2024. The new consoles, like the PlayStation 5 and Xbox Series X, arrived to provide powerful high-charge GPUs, ray tracing, and faster load times, making gaming go faster. Advancements in graphics cards, high-refresh-rate displays, and mechanical keyboards spurred PC gaming.
Cloud gaming and portable hardware like the Steam Deck made it more accessible. Things that trail behind the esports and streaming consumption fantasy, like professional-class peripherals for ergonomics and hi-fi headsets, were pushing growth in the component set.
Expansion continued, albeit it was “muted” due to global chip shortages, supply chain losses and increasing component cost, it said. Producers were forced to provide energy-efficient technology and recyclable materials, as sustainability called for.

The industry confronts numerous risks such as supply chain interruptions, technological novelty, regulatory problems, consumer cybersecurity threats, and adaptation to consumer shifts. In order to be equal to the competition, both producers and suppliers should act fast in risk performance and adjust to the quick-transforming trade environment.
Supply chain disruptions, which are related to semiconductor circuits and other components, are the top risk. The disruption in the supply chain was mainly caused by shortfalls, wars, and production delays which raised the cost of manufacturing and the time taken for the products to be ready leading to the item being either unavailable to the customers or priced high.
Companies need to adopt the strategy of suppliers' diversification, by selecting multiple suppliers, and efficient inventory management systems to reduce risks.
Regulatory challenges as well as import/export restrictions can have negative impact on industry progress. Some regions are strict with the environmental, safety, and trade policies that affect the manufacturing and distribution of the industry. Companies need to comply with the regulatory requirements and ensure that they achieve cost efficiency concurrently for them to outperform the competition.
Cybersecurity threats stand out, borne largely upon the fact that the industry is sophisticated and more interconnected. Cloud gaming, online multiplayer, and IoT integrated devices are under constant risk from data breaches, hacking, and piracy. The main plan should be the installation of the strongest security protocols and the most up-to-date firmware to obviate the dangers to companies as well as to the consumers.
The manufacturers could keep their presence in the industry and exploit the industry's growth by using the risks mitigation through long-term strategies such as planning, technological diversification, and making the supply chain resilient.

The industry is segmented into PC gaming (PC gaming hardware) and TV gaming (TV gaming hardware); both platforms are driving industry growth through technological advancements and changing consumer preferences.
Gaming Hardware in PC is the major segment owing to high demand for Gaming laptops and desktops & peripherals. While the popularity of eSports, competitive gaming, and AAA game titles continue to inspire gamers, higher spending on graphics processing units (GPUs), gaming monitors, mechanical keyboards, and VR-compatible systems is being fueled.
Graphics giants like NVIDIA, AMD, and ASUS are gearing up for high-refresh-rate displays, ray-tracing GPUs, and AI-powered processors for seamless gaming. Furthermore, services such as NVIDIA GeForce Now and Xbox Cloud Gaming enable more gameplay without having to invest in high-end hardware, making it an attractive feature for hardcore gamers.
TV Gaming Hardware remains the leading platform, leading with a 43.4% share in the 2025 industry. Because more people are using gaming consoles like the PlayStation, Xbox, and Nintendo Switch, which all contribute to growth, smart TVs are providing a better gaming experience.
In addition to all of that, console gaming is reaching new heights thanks to high dynamic range (HDR), HDMI 2.1 support, and increasingly larger 4K and even 8K TVs. In order to improve performance, Sony, Microsoft, and LG are developing new gaming-specific TVs with variable refresh rates (VRR) and low-latency settings.
The industry includes both consoles and accessories, both of which are essential components that greatly enhance both the industry and the whole gaming experience.
High-performance gaming systems continue to dominate the gaming console industry. In 2025, consoles will account for 18.3% of the industry, with the Nintendo Switch, Microsoft's Xbox Series X/S, and Sony's PlayStation 5 leading the way. In addition to expensive, unique games, more consoles have been introduced due to backward compatibility and efficient cloud gaming integration.
New direct on the new generation gaming consoles are adopting ray-tracing graphics, high refresh rates (120Hz), and Solid State Drive (SSD) storage solutions to eliminate waiting times and provide better gameplay.
Also, the trend of purchasing games digitally and through subscription-based gaming services such as Xbox Game Pass and PlayStation Plus is affecting the console industry. With changing industry dynamics and shifting consumer expectations, companies are also working on hybrid and portable console designs like Nintendo Switch OLED and ASUS ROG Ally.
Gaming accessories are also a vital part of typing, audio, sensitivity, touch response, etc., and experience enhancers with products like gaming headsets, mechanical keyboards, VR headsets, gaming controllers, etc. That segment seems set to expand, and we are witnessing an industry-wide boom in demand for pro-quality peripherals targeted at competitive gaming and streaming.
Others, including Razer, Logitech, and Corsair, are issuing heads-up pairs with AI-enabled audio to remount users in the sport and keyboards that can be aligned for customized RGB colors and buttons on the fly, along with new nectar varieties. VR gaming hardware, including Meta Quest, PlayStation VR2, and HTC Vive, is also broadening the accessory horizon.

By gaming platform, the industry is divided into gaming hardware for PCs, TVs, smartphone gaming.
By product type, the industry includes gaming hardware in consoles (standard consoles, handheld consoles) and gaming hardware accessories (headsets, cameras, gamepads, steering wheels, and joysticks).
By end-user, the industry is segmented into residential and commercial gaming hardware.
By region, the industry spans the North America, Latin America, Europe, Asia Pacific, and Middle East and Africa.
